    About CG PET 2026 Exam

    The Chhattisgarh Vyavasayik Pariksha Mandal (CVPM) or CG Vyapam is the conducting authority for CG PET exam. It is held for BTech admission to various courses offered by the participating institutes of CG PET in the state. Candidates will be able to get admissions based on scores secured n the CG PET 2026 entrance exam. The authority will conduct the CG PET 2026 as a pen-paper-based exam.

    There are certain conditions and requirements that students willing to appear for the CG Pre Engineering Test will have to fulfil. Candidates can check the detailed CG PET eligibility criteria from the official website. Below are the CG PET eligibility criteria for the candidate’s reference:

    • Qualifying examination: Must pass class 12 or equivalent exam from a recognized board with physics and mathematics as the compulsory subjects. Candidates can have chemistry, biotechnology, biology, technical vocational courses as their optional subjects in class 12 or equivalent exam.

    • Qualifying Marks: General category candidates must have a minimum aggregate of 45% marks in the qualifying exam. The reserved category (SC/ST/OBC/female and PWD) should have a minimum aggregate of 40% marks in the qualifying exam.

    • Age Criteria: Applicant should not be less than 17 years as of December 31, 2025. While the upper age limit is 30 years. That is, candidates should not be more than 30 years old as of July 1 of the exam year. For the reserved category, there is 3 years relaxation in the upper age limit.

    • Domicile: It is a must to provide a domicile certificate as per the guidelines laid down by the government.

    The authority has released the exam pattern of CG PET 2026 online. The exam pattern of CG PET 2026 consists of marking scheme, mode of examination, type of questions, duration of test, and more. Below is the CG PET exam pattern.

    CG PET 2026 Exam Pattern

    ParticularsDeatils

    Mode of Exam

    Offline - Pen and paper-based exam

    Duration of Exam

    3 hours (180 minutes)

    Types of Questions

    Objective - Multiple Choice Questions

    Sections

    • Physics
    • Chemistry
    • Mathematics

    Total Number of Questions

    150 questions

    Sectional Distribution of Questions

    • Physics - 50 questions
    • Chemistry - 50 questions
    • Mathematics - 50 questions

    Marking Scheme

    1 mark shall be awarded for each correct response

    Negative Marking

    There is no negative marking

    Maximum Marks

    150 Marks

    CG PET 2026 Syllabus

    CG PET Chhattisgarh Pre Engineering Test Syllabus

    Physics: Unit 01


    Measurement
    • Units and dimensions, fundamental and derived units, dimensional analysis, S.I. units

    Physics: Unit 02


    Kinematics
    • Linear motion in one and two dimensions, cases of uniform velocity and uniform acceleration, general relation among position and velocity, uniform circulation motion

    Physics: Unit 03


    Force and laws of motion
    • Force and inertia, Newton's law of motion, conservation of momentum and energy static, and kinetic friction, uniform circular motion

    Physics: Unit 04


    Work, energy, and power
    • Work done by force, energy, power, elastic collisions, potential energy, gravitational potential energy and its angular conversion to kinetic energy, potential energy of a spring

    Physics: Unit 05


    Rotational motion and moment of inertia
    • Rigid body rotation, couple, torque, angular momentum conservation of its momentum, moment of inertia, theorems of parallel and perpendicular axis (moment of inertia of uniform ring, disc thin rod, and cylinder only)

    Physics: Unit 06


    Gravitation
    • Acceleration due to gravity and its variation, universal law of gravitation, motion of satellites, escape velocity, synchronous satellite and polar satellite

    Physics: Unit 07


    Properties of solids and fluids
    • Elasticity, Hook's law, Young's modulus, shear and bulk modulus, surface energy and surface tension, fluid pressure, atmospheric pressure, viscosity of fluids, kinetic theory of gases, gas laws, kinetic energy and temperature

    Physics: Unit 08


    Heat and thermodynamics
    • Heat, temperature, thermometers, specific heats at constant volume and constant pressure, mechanical equivalent of heat isothermal and adiabatic processes
    • Heat conduction in one dimension
    • Convection and radiation, Stefan's law and Newton's law of cooling, zeroth, first, and second law of thermodynamics

    Physics: Unit 09


    Oscillation
    • Periodic motion, simple harmonic motion, oscillations in spring, laws of simple pendulum

    Physics: Unit 10


    Waves
    • Transverse and longitudinal wave motion, speed of sound, principle of superposition, progressive and stationary waves, beats and Doppler effect

    Physics: Unit 11


    Light
    • Wave nature of light, interference, Young's double slit experiment, velocity of light and Doppler's effect in light, reflection, refraction, total internal reflection, curved mirrors, lenses, mirror and lens formulae, dispersion in prism
    • Absorption and emission spectra, optical instruments
    • The human eye, defects of vision, magnification and resolving power of telescope and microscope

    Physics: Unit 12


    Magnetism
    • Bar magnet, lines of force, torque on a bar magnet due to magnetic field, earth's magnetic field, tangent galvanometer, vibration magnetometer, paramagnetic, diamagnetic, and ferromagnetic substances

    Physics: Unit 13


    Electrostatistics
    • Coulomb's law of electrostatics, dielectric constant, electric field and potential due to a point charge, dipole, dipole field, Gauss's law in simple geometric
    • Electrostatic potential, capacitance, parallel plate and spherical capacitors, capacitors in series and parallel, energy of a capacitor

    Physics: Unit 14


    Current electricity
    • Electric current, Ohm's law, Kirchhoff's laws, resistances in series and parallel, temperature dependence of resistance, Wheatstone bridge and potentiometer
    • Measurement of voltages and currents

    Physics: Unit 15


    Effect of electric current
    • Magnetic thermal and chemical effect of current, electric power heating effects of currents, chemical effects and law of electrolysis, thermoelectricity, Biot-Savart law, magnetic fields due to a straight wire, circular loop and solenoid
    • Force on a moving charge in a magnetic field (Lorentz force), magnetic moment of a current loop, effect of a uniform magnetic field of a current loop, forces between two currents, moving galvanometer, ammeter and voltmeter

    Physics: Unit 16


    Electromagnetic induction and alternating current
    • Magnetic flux, electromagnetic induction, induced EMF, Faraday's law, Lenz's law, self and mutual inductance, alternating currents impedance and reactance growth, and decay of current in L-R circuit, elementary idea of dynamo and transformer

    Physics: Unit 17


    Electron, photon, and radioactivity
    • e' and 'e/m' for an electron, photon, Einstein's photoelectric equation, photocells
    • Bohr model of the atom, Hydrogen spectrum, Composition of nucleus, atomic masses and isotopes, radioactivity, laws of radioactive decay, decay constant, half-life and mean life, Mass-energy relation, fission, X-Ray: properties and uses

    Physics: Unit 18


    Semiconductor
    • Elementary ideas of conductor, semiconductor and insulator, intrinsic and extrinsic semiconductors, diode, transistor, oscillator, digital circuit and logic gates

    Physical chemistry: Unit 01


    Atomic structure
    • Constitution of nucleus, Bohr's atom model, quantum numbers, Aufbau principle, electronic configuration of elements (up to-Kr), De-Broglie relation, shapes of orbital

    Physical chemistry: Unit 02


    Chemical bond
    • Electrovalent covalent and covalent bonds, hybridization (sp): Hydrogen bond, shapes of molecules (VSEPR theory), bond polarity resonance, elements of VBT

    Physical chemistry: Unit 03


    Solutions
    • Modes of expressing concentrations of solutions: Types of solutions, Raoult's law of colligative properties, non-ideal solution, and abnormal molecular weights

    Physical chemistry: Unit 04


    Solid state
    • Crystal lattices, unit cells, structure of ionic compounds close packed structure, ionic radii, imperfections (point defects): Properties of solids

    Physical chemistry: Unit 05


    Nuclear chemistry
    • Radioactive radiations: Half-life, radioactive decay, group displacement law, structure and properties of nucleus: Nuclear reactions, disintegration series, artificial transmutation: Isotopes and their uses, radiocarbon dating

    Physical chemistry: Unit 06


    Chemical equilibrium
    • Chemical equilibrium, law of mass action Kp and Kc: Le Chatelier's principle and its applications

    Physical chemistry: Unit 07


    Ionic equilibrium
    • Ionic equilibria in solutions, solubility product, common ion effect, theories of acids and base hydrolysis of salts: pH, buffers

    Physical chemistry: Unit 08


    Thermochemistry and thermodynamics
    • Energy changes during a chemical reaction intrinsic energy, enthalpy, first law of thermodynamics: Hess's law, heats of reactions, second law of thermodynamics, entropy, free energy
    • Spontaneity of a chemical reaction, free energy change and chemical equilibrium, free energy as energy available for useful work

    Physical chemistry: Unit 09


    Chemical kinetics
    • Rate of a reaction, factors affecting the rate, rate constant, rate expression, order of reaction, first order rate constant-expression and characteristics, Arrhenius equation

    Physical chemistry: Unit 10


    Electrochemistry
    • Oxidation, oxidation number and ion-electron methods, electrolytic conduction, Faraday's laws: Voltaic cell, electrode potentials, electromotive force, Gibb's energy and cell potentials, Nernst equation, commercial cells, fuel cell
    • Electrochemical theory of corrosion

    Physical chemistry: Unit 11


    Surface chemistry
    • Colloids and catalysis, adsorption, colloids (types, preparation, and properties), emulsions, catalysis: Types and characteristics

    Inorganic chemistry: Unit 01


    Principles of metallurgical operations
    • Furnaces, ore concentration, extraction, purification metallurgies of Na, Al, Fe, Cu, Ag, Zn, and Pb and their properties

    Inorganic chemistry: Unit 02


    Chemical periodicity
    • s, p, d, and f-block elements, periodic table, periodicity, atomic and ionic radii valency, ionization energy, electron affinity, electro negativity, metallic character

    Inorganic chemistry: Unit 03


    Comparative study of elements
    • Comparative study of the following families of element: (i) alkali metals (ii) alkaline earth metals (iii) nitrogen family (iv) oxygen family (v) halogens (vi) noble gases

    Inorganic chemistry: Unit 04


    Transitions metals
    • Electronic configuration of 3rd metal ions, oxidation states, other general characteristic properties, potassium permanganate, potassium dichromate

    Inorganic chemistry: Unit 05


    Coordination compound
    • Simple nomenclature, bonding and stability, classification and bonding in organometallics

    Inorganic chemistry: Unit 06


    Chemical analysis
    • Chemistry involved is simple inorganic qualitative analysis, calculations based on acid base titrimetry

    Organic chemistry: Unit 01


    Chemistry of hydrocarbon
    • Calculation of empirical and molecular formulae of organic compounds, nomenclature of organic compounds, common functional groups, isomerism, structure and shapes of alkanes, alkenes, and benzene
    • Preparation, properties, and uses of alkanes, alkenes, and alkynes, benzene, petroleum, cracking, octane number, gasoline additives

    Organic chemistry: Unit 02


    Organic compounds based on functional group containing nitrogen
    • Nomenclature, methods preparation, chemical properties, correlations of physical properties with structures and uses of nitro, amino, cyana, and diazo compounds

    Organic chemistry: Unit 03


    Organic compounds containing organic oxygens
    • Nomenclature, methods preparation, chemical properties, correlations of physical properties with structures and uses of ethers, aldehydes, ketones, carboxylic acids, and their derivatives

    Organic chemistry: Unit 04


    Chemistry in daily life
    • Polymers: Classification, method of preparation, properties and uses of polymers, dyes: Classification, structure of some important dyes
    • Chemistry of drug: Introduction and classification, chemotherapy, importance of drug (antipyretic, antiseptic, antibiotic, anesthetics), chemistry in food, cosmetics, and detergent

    Organic chemistry: Unit 05


    Biomolecules
    • Classification, structures, and biological importance of carbohydrates, amino acids, peptides, proteins and enzymes, nucleic acids, and lipids

    Mathematics: Unit 01


    Algebra
    • Algebra of complex numbers, graphical representation of complex numbers, modulus and argument of complex numbers, square root of a complex number, triangular inequality
    • Cube roots of unity
    • Arithmetic, geometric, and harmonic progression, arithmetic, geometric, and harmonic means between two numbers
    • Sum of squares and cubes of first natural numbers
    • Quadratic equations, relations between roots and coefficients, permutations and combinations, binomial theorem (any index) exponential and logarithmic series
    • Determinants up to third order and their order and their elementary properties, matrices types of matrices, adjoint and inverse of matrix, elementary properties of matrices
    • Partial fraction
    • Application in solving simultaneous equations up to three variables

    Mathematics: Unit 02


    Trigonometry
    • Trigonometry functions and their graphs, addition and subtraction formula involving multiple and submultiples angles, general solutions of triangles equations, relations between sides and angles of a triangles, solutions of triangles, inverse
    • Trigonometrically functions, height and distance (simple problems)

    Mathematics: Unit 03


    Coordinate geometry of two dimensions
    • Rectangular Cartesian coordinates, straight-line pair to straight line, distance of a point from a line angle between two lines
    • Circle, tangents, and normal system of circles
    • Conic section parabola, ellipse, and hyperbola in standard forms with elementary, properties tangents and normal

    Mathematics: Unit 04


    Coordinate geometry of three dimensions
    • Rectangular coordinate system, direction cosine and direction ratios, equation of place in standard forms
    • Perpendicular distance from a point, equation of a line angle between two lines

    Mathematics: Unit 05


    Vector algebra
    • Definition of vector, addition of vectors, components in three dimensional space, scalar and vector products
    • Triple products, simple application in geometry and mechanics

    Mathematics: Unit 06


    Differential calculus
    • Function polynomial, rational trigonometric, logarithmic and exponential
    • Inverse function, limit, continuity, and differentiability of functions, differentiation of rational, trigonometric and exponential functions
    • Application of derivative in elementary problems in mechanics increasing and decreasing functions
    • Maxima and Minima of function of one variable
    • Roll's theorem and mean value theorem

    Mathematics: Unit 07


    Integral calculus
    • Integrations as the inverse process of differentiations, integration by the parts, by substitution and by partial fraction
    • Definite integral, areas under simple cures

    Mathematics: Unit 08


    Differential equations
    • Formulation of differential equation, order and degree, solutions of differential equations by separation of variable method
    • Homogeneous linear differential equation of first order

    Mathematics: Unit 09


    Statistics
    • Probability addition and multiplication laws, conditional probability, binomial distribution, simple problems in correlation and regression

    Mathematics: Unit 10


    Numerical methods
    • Solution of equation by the methods of bisection, false-position and Newton-Raphson
    • Numerical integration by trapezoidal and Simpson's rule

    Mathematics: Unit 11


    Information technology
    • Basics of computer and its operations, functional components, main parts of computer, input devices, output devices and secondary storage devices, system software, utility software, application software

    CG PET Exam Result 2026 - Tie-breaking rule

    In the case of two or more candidates who have the same marks in CG PET, inter-se-merit will be followed. Mentioned below is the inter-se-merit rule that will be followed:

    • Candidates having higher scores in mathematics will be given a better merit rank above all. If a tie still exists, 

    • Physics scores will be considered. If a tie still exists,

    • Candidates older in age will be given priority. If the candidates' age is also the same, their scores from class XII will be considered.

    The authority will release the CG PET 2026 cutoff on the official website. The cutoff is the minimum mark required for admission to the participating institutes. Candidates whose marks in CG PET 2026 are more than the cutoff will be considered for admission. The authority will consider various factors like the number of candidates, the difficulty level of the qualifying exam, previous year's cutoff trends to determine the CG PET 2026 cutoff. Authorities will release the cutoff for the state and other state candidates separately.

    DTE Chhattisgarh will release the CG PET counselling date 2026 after the declaration of result. Candidates who qualify the CG PET exam will be able to participate in the counselling process. Chhattisgarh PET counselling 2026 will comprise option filling, document verification, fee payment, seat allotment, reporting etc. Candidates will be allotted seats based on the choice filling, availability of seats, and marks secured by the candidates. Below is the CG PET counselling process.

    CG PET 2026 Counselling Process:

    The following steps are involved in the CG PET counselling process.

    1st Step: Registration - Candidates need to register for CG PET 2026 by providing the necessary details.

    2nd Step: Upload required documents - Now, they need to upload the required documents in the specified format.

    Documents

    File Size

    File Format

    Photograph

    40 KB to 50 KB

    JPG/ JPEG

    Signature

    40 KB to 50 KB

    JPG/ JPEG

    3rd Step: Fee payment - The CG PET counselling fee can be paid online mode through credit/debit card or internet banking.

    4th Step: Choice Locking -

    • The candidates have to fill in the institute's choices and courses as per the schedule. 

    • They will have the option to add, delete, modify and rearrange their choices. 

    • Candidates have to lock their choices before the last date and take a printout along with the filled choices.

    5th Step: Document Verification - After the choice locking process is completed, they will have to report to the allotted centres for the document verification process. He/She should bring their original documents along with photocopies to the facility centres. The exam authorities will provide a receipt cum acknowledgement slip to the candidates after the document verification process.
